Go Back
Adam

High Protein Stuffed Pepper Soup – Hearty, Filling & Packed with Flavor

If you love stuffed peppers but want something easier, cozier, and even more satisfying, this High Protein Stuffed Pepper Soup is the perfect recipe for you. It captures all the classic flavors of stuffed peppers — tender bell peppers, savory beef, tomatoes, herbs, and rice — and transforms them into a warm, hearty soup full of comfort and nourishment. What makes this soup especially appealing is its high protein content. With lean ground beef, plenty of vegetables, and a balanced amount of rice, this soup delivers long-lasting fullness, steady energy, and an incredibly comforting experience in each spoonful. The tomato broth is seasoned with basil, oregano, garlic, parsley, and a touch of heat from red pepper flakes, creating a flavorful, fragrant base that feels like traditional stuffed peppers simmered to perfection. This soup is ideal for meal prep, weeknight dinners, fitness-focused meals, or cozy winter evenings when you want something filling, wholesome, and easy to make. It's nutritious, balanced, and incredibly satisfying.
Prep Time 10 minutes
Cook Time 35 minutes
Total Time 45 minutes
Servings: 8 servings

Ingredients
  

Meat
  • 1 lb ground beef lean preferred
Vegetables
  • 1 cup diced onion
  • 2 cups chopped bell peppers red, yellow, or orange
  • ½ tablespoon minced garlic
  • ½ teaspoon dried basil
  • ½ teaspoon dried oregano
  • ½ teaspoon dried parsley
  • 1 bay leaf
Canned & Pantry
  • 1 14.5 oz can petite diced tomatoes
  • 1 15 oz can tomato sauce
Liquids
  • 2 cups low-sodium beef broth
  • 3 cups water
Rice
  • cup long-grain white rice
Seasonings
  • ¼ teaspoon black pepper
  • ¼ teaspoon red pepper flakes
  • Salt to taste
Oil
  • 1 tablespoon extra virgin olive oil

Equipment

  • Large soup pot or Dutch oven
  • Cutting board
  • Sharp knife
  • Wooden spoon
  • Measuring cups & spoons
  • Ladle
  • Optional: Fine strainer for rinsing rice

Method
 

Step 1 — Brown the ground beef
  1. Heat the olive oil in a large soup pot over medium-high heat.
  2. Add the ground beef, breaking it apart with a wooden spoon.
  3. Cook until browned and fully cooked through.
  4. Drain excess fat if needed.
Step 2 — Add vegetables
  1. Add the diced onion and chopped bell peppers.
  2. Cook for 5–7 minutes until they begin to soften.
  3. Stir in the minced garlic and cook for 1 more minute.
Step 3 — Season the base
  1. Add dried basil, oregano, parsley, black pepper, red pepper flakes, and the bay leaf.
  2. Stir well so the spices bloom in the heat.
Step 4 — Add tomatoes & liquids
  1. Pour in the petite diced tomatoes, tomato sauce, beef broth, and water.
  2. Stir to combine.
Step 5 — Add the rice
  1. Rinse the rice briefly under cold water, then stir it into the pot.
  2. Bring the soup to a gentle boil.
Step 6 — Simmer
  1. Reduce heat to low, cover, and simmer for 25–30 minutes, or until rice is tender and flavors are blended.
Step 7 — Taste & adjust
  1. Remove the bay leaf.
  2. Add salt or extra seasoning as needed.
Step 8 — Serve warm
  1. Ladle into bowls and enjoy a cozy, hearty high-protein meal.

Notes

🧊 Storage & Reheating
Refrigerator
Keeps 4–5 days in airtight containers.
Rice will absorb liquid — add water or broth when reheating.
Freezer
Freeze before adding rice for best texture (up to 2 months).
Add freshly cooked rice after reheating.
Reheating
Heat on low. Add broth to thin as needed.
🥄 Variations
1. Low-Carb Version
Replace rice with cauliflower rice (add during last 5 minutes).
2. High-Protein Boost
Add kidney beans, black beans, or extra beef.
3. Spicy Version
Increase red pepper flakes or add a chopped jalapeño.
4. Veggie-Loaded Soup
Add zucchini, mushrooms, or spinach.
5. Tomato-Rich Version
Add 2 tablespoons tomato paste.
6. Cheesy Stuffed Pepper Soup
Add shredded cheddar on top.
7. Chicken Version
Swap beef with ground chicken or turkey.
8. Smoky Version
Add smoked paprika.
9. Brothy Version
Add an extra cup of beef broth.
10. Thick & Stew-Like
Let the soup simmer uncovered to reduce liquid.
❓ 10 FAQs
1. Is this really high in protein?
Yes — thanks to lean beef and optional bean additions.
2. Can I use brown rice?
Yes, but increase cooking time by 10–15 minutes.
3. Can I make it spicy?
Add more chili flakes or cayenne.
4. Can I make it gluten-free?
Yes — all ingredients are naturally gluten-free.
5. Can I freeze this soup?
Yes — freeze without rice for best results.
6. Can I use chicken broth instead of beef broth?
Yes — the flavor will be slightly lighter.
7. Can I add garlic powder?
Yes — but fresh garlic adds richer flavor.
8. What peppers work best?
Red, orange, or yellow — they add sweetness.
9. Can I use ground turkey?
Absolutely — great lower-fat option.
10. Can I add cheese?
Yes — shredded cheddar or mozzarella on top is delicious.
🏁 Conclusion
This High Protein Stuffed Pepper Soup is hearty, nourishing, and packed with comforting flavors inspired by classic stuffed peppers. With lean ground beef, vibrant bell peppers, tomatoes, herbs, and rice, this soup is full of protein, fiber, and satisfying warmth.
It’s the perfect one-pot meal for meal prep, family dinners, fitness goals, or cozy winter nights — easy to make, deeply flavorful, and wonderfully filling.